Why is innovation a must in education?

The Changing Landscape of Education

Over the past decade, the world has witnessed unprecedented technological breakthroughs and societal shifts. The digital revolution, automation, artificial intelligence, and globalisation have transformed industries and created new opportunities and challenges. Education must transform significantly to equip students with the skills and knowledge necessary to navigate this ever-changing landscape. Traditional models of education, characterised by rote memorisation and standardised testing, are no longer sufficient to prepare students for the future.

Fostering Creativity and Critical Thinking

Innovation in education encourages creativity and critical thinking skills, essential for success in the modern world. Students can explore complex issues, think critically, and propose creative solutions by promoting inquiry-based learning, problem-solving, and collaboration. This approach fosters a growth mindset, cultivating a lifelong love for learning and enabling students to adapt to new challenges throughout their lives.

Personalised Learning and Differentiated Instruction

One of the critical advantages of innovation in education is the ability to personalise learning experiences based on individual needs and strengths. Using technology and data analytics, educators can tailor instruction to meet the unique requirements of each student. Personalised learning enables students to progress at their own pace, explore their interests, and receive immediate feedback, leading to higher engagement and improved learning outcomes.

Technology Integration in the Classroom

Integrating technology into the classroom is a crucial aspect of educational innovation. Digital tools and platforms provide students access to vast information and resources, enhancing their learning experience beyond the limitations of traditional textbooks. Virtual reality, augmented reality, online simulations, and educational apps offer immersive and interactive learning opportunities, making complex concepts more accessible and engaging.

Preparing Students for the Future Workforce

The rapid advancements in technology and automation are reshaping the job market. To prepare students for the future workforce, education must focus on developing high-demand skills, such as problem-solving, critical thinking, communication, collaboration, and digital literacy. By embracing innovation in teaching, schools can bridge the gap between academia and industry, ensuring students have the skills necessary for success in the 21st-century job market.

Overcoming Challenges and Promoting Innovation

While the benefits of innovation in education are clear, implementing and sustaining innovative practices can be challenging. Limited funding, resistance to change, and lack of professional development opportunities for educators are common obstacles. To promote innovation, stakeholders, including policymakers, educators, parents, and the wider community, must collaborate and support initiatives that foster creativity, provide necessary resources, and offer continuous professional development.

Cultivating Entrepreneurial Mindset

Innovation in education nurtures an entrepreneurial mindset among students. It encourages them to identify problems, think creatively, and develop innovative solutions. By incorporating entrepreneurship education into the curriculum, students gain essential skills such as risk-taking, resilience, adaptability, and resourcefulness. These skills are valuable for starting businesses and navigating the complexities of the modern world, fostering an innovative and enterprising mindset that can drive societal progress.

Promoting Global Awareness and Cultural Competence

Innovation in education allows for exploring diverse perspectives, cultures, and global issues. It promotes global awareness and cultural competence among students, preparing them to be active global citizens. Through innovative teaching methods such as virtual exchanges, online collaborations, and multicultural projects, students gain a deeper understanding of different cultures, develop empathy, and learn to work effectively in diverse teams. This global perspective is crucial in an increasingly interconnected world, fostering tolerance, cooperation, and a broader understanding of global challenges.

Encouraging Lifelong Learning

Innovation in education instils a love for lifelong learning in students. Traditional education often focuses on acquiring knowledge rather than developing a thirst for continuous learning. However, innovation-driven approaches, such as project-based, inquiry-based, and self-directed learning, engage students in active exploration and encourage them to take ownership of their education. By fostering curiosity, adaptability, and a growth mindset, innovation in education empowers students to become lifelong learners who embrace new ideas, seek growth opportunities, and stay updated in an ever-changing world.

Addressing Learning Diversity and Inclusion

Innovation in education provides opportunities to address learning diversity and promote inclusivity. Every student has unique strengths, interests, and learning styles. Innovative approaches allow educators to cater to these individual differences, ensuring all students have equitable access to education. Technology-assisted learning, adaptive learning platforms, and assistive technologies can accommodate diverse learning needs, including students with disabilities, English language learners, and those who require additional support. By embracing innovation, education can break down barriers to learning and create an inclusive environment that celebrates diversity.

Fostering Social and Emotional Learning

Innovation in education recognises the importance of social and emotional learning (SEL) alongside academic achievement. SEL encompasses self-awareness, self-management, social awareness, relationship skills, and responsible decision-making. By incorporating innovative teaching methods such as mindfulness practices, collaborative projects, and experiential learning, education can foster the development of these crucial skills. SEL equips students with the emotional intelligence and resilience needed to navigate interpersonal relationships, manage stress, and make responsible choices, ultimately contributing to their overall well-being and success.
